The Assistant Regulatory Accountant plays a vital role in the Finance team, contributing to operational excellence and strategic delivery. The role supports key financial processes and ensures compliance, accuracy, and efficiency across systems and reporting. Working closely with stakeholders, this role involves managing workflows, supporting system improvements, and delivering insights that drive business decisions. You will also complete regulatory returns in relation to capital expenditure for Annual Performance Reporting, Price Reviews and other regulatory consultations. Key responsibilities Support and improve financial systems and processes Ensure accurate and timely reporting and data management Collaborate with internal teams and our economic regulator Ofwat to deliver financial insights and key external reporting Maintain compliance with financial regulations and standards Drive continuous improvement and operational efficiency Provide technical expertise and support to stakeholders Help develop and improve the existing capital accounting policies manual Support Group Tax with HMRC submissions and enquiries by providing background documentation, analysis and calculations Provide expertise to strategic investment boards on the accounting impact of proposed investments As a valued employee you’ll be entitled to: A competitive pension scheme where we double-match your contributions up to 6% Private healthcare for your peace of mind An annual bonus scheme The opportunity to volunteer in your local community 25 days holiday (plus Bank Holidays), increasing with service, with the option to swap Christmas and Easter for religious holidays Life cover (8x your salary) and personal accident cover (up to 5x your salary) Flexible benefits to support your well-being and lifestyle Paid time off for illness, both physical and mental Free parking at all office locations, sites, and leisure parks Excellent family-friendly policies, including 26 weeks of full pay for maternity/adoption leave and 4 weeks of paternity/partner pay, with the opportunity for shared parental leave What does it take to be successful? Part Qualified Accountant (ACCA/CIMA or equivalent) Accounting experience Understanding of Capital Investment Process Proactive, detail-oriented, and collaborative Excellent IT awareness, especially SAP, Tagetik and MS Office applications Strong and proven prioritising and decision-making skills Keen desire for accuracy and attention to detail Inclusion at Anglian Water: Inclusion is for everyone and we are an equal opportunity employer, which means we’ll consider all suitably qualified applicants regardless of gender identity or expression, ethnic origin, nationality, religion or beliefs, age, sexual orientation, disability status or any other protected characteristic.
